The Guyana Prison Service (GPS) is strengthened with 32 new officers after an intensive three-month training programme under Recruit Course 3/2026.
The recruits have undergone rigorous training to prepare for essential roles in prison administration, inmate rehabilitation support, facility operations, and broader national security functions.
Their deployment will significantly enhance the GPS’s capacity, while offering young Guyanese dignified career pathways within one of the country’s key security institutions.
